Output 7d043eac9ed3a1602c52b51a3ee8c5f3f421e7ca462dc99f8089379b074f70f6:0

value
315560
script pubkey
OP_0 OP_PUSHBYTES_20 bdbe8ef303eea19edb7605679cca06d7048faefb
address
bc1qhklgaucra6seakmkq4neejsx6uzglthmv56ske
transaction
7d043eac9ed3a1602c52b51a3ee8c5f3f421e7ca462dc99f8089379b074f70f6
confirmations
198260
spent
true